Division Summary
ITW Residential Mechanical Fastening offers a broad range of professional grade tools and fasteners for numerous construction applications. Our products include structural wood fasteners (GRK Fasteners™), concrete anchoring systems (Tapcon®, Red Head®, Ramset®), underlayment screws (Backer-On Rock-On ®), self-drilling screws (Teks®) and drywall anchoring systems (E-Z Ancor®). ITW Residential Mechanical Fastening excels in meeting the growing demands from Pro end-users for high-quality home improvement and construction fastening products.
Our products are trusted by industry professionals and each brand is the market leader in its respective category in terms of quality, performance and ease of use.
Position Summary
This position is responsible for the setup, operation, and preventative maintenance of Fastener Manufacturing equipment to produce according to quality specifications safely. This is a 1st shift position. The hours are 6am - 230pm, Monday - Friday.
Primary Responsibilities
- Performs setup and operates a variety of in-lined equipment to cold head, point and thread-roll fasteners for commercial construction applications.
- Perform routine and non-routine maintenance on equipment, including preventive maintenance tasks.
- Performs quality checks in adherence to specifications sheets including first piece approval; will also be responsible for documentation.
- Drives safety practices and procedures including identifying safety hazards.
- Analyze and troubleshoot production and equipment failures.
- Perform full inspection of all incoming tooling.
- Responsible for monitoring the performance of production equipment and supporting implementation of upgrades and enhancements to equipment and fixtures.
- Assist with the installation of equipment as needed.
- Ensures all housekeeping practices and procedures are met.
- Performs 6-S activities and improvements as required.
- Conducts final inspections of all finished products and signs off on compliance with specifications.
- Works with and trains other team members and participates in team events and meetings.
- Must be willing and able to work as machine operator running lines.
- Other duties as assigned.
